I've found a handful of stuff over the years. I'll have to pull the wax though to remember.

 

I know I have the "when you're smiling" bit. It's off a soundtrack.

 

He samples either Buckner and Garcia or the Namco Video Game Music LP (pacman sounds) for F U Pacman.

 

He samples the We Will Rock You Drums on Murder Factory.

 

The Beck sample referred to earlier (I'm an alien . . .) is either on Stereopathetic Soulmanure or a Western Harvest Feild By Moonlight, I can't remember which. If it's Western Harvest that's pretty deep digs.

 

And yeah, he samples all types of shit off the "Ghost Weed" skits on De La's AOI (niggas still fussin, etc. etc. etc.)
